Yesterday the top for my new hunting rig that I plan on giving a lot of critters their last ride in came in & was put on. With my son getting older & wanting to hunt out of state with me, so I think this will serve us well. I plan on getting a DAC mid-size truck cap tent for this rig & a good foam mattress or a Truck AirBedz.
For years I would sleep in the front seat of the Bowtie Inn but I'm not as young anymore & my body can't take it. It will be nice to have options for roosting birds the night before that's cheap, easy & not far from where I want to hunt.
So does anyone else uses their rig as an over night camper, what's your set up? If so, please let's hear or see them.

Quote from: Bigstruttin on January 17, 2014, 11:54:52 AM
I have a 2013 dbl cab short bed tacoma although I've never camped in it before I don't think I could.
Sure you could if you did it right :icon_thumright: Even though I'm 6' & my truck bed is 60"....it will work. The DAC tent I'm getting sets up with using tailgate down & cap door up. That gives me 80" from the one end of the bed to the end of the tailgate to lay out in comfort.
